The principal feature of the redesigned checks is a series of printed instructions that the company hopes will help merchants confirm a check’s authenticity, which includes reminders to watch the endorsement, compare signatures, and view the watermark while holding the check to the light.

A. which includes reminders to watch the endorsement, compare signatures, and view
B. which include reminders for watching the endorsement, to compare signatures and view
C. by including reminders for watching the endorsement, comparing signatures, and viewing
D. including reminders to watch the endorsement, comparing signatures and viewing
E. including reminders to watch the endorsement, compare signatures, and view

E is my choice

E
"which" incorrectly refers to "authenticity"- A and B out.
E for parallelism - to watch, compare and view.
